]> git.saurik.com Git - apt.git/blame - buildlib/libversion.mak
[BREAK] merge MultiArch-ABI. We don't support MultiArch,
[apt.git] / buildlib / libversion.mak
CommitLineData
23d84658
DK
1# -*- make -*-
2# Version number of libapt-pkg.
3# Please increase MAJOR with each ABI break,
4# with each non-ABI break to the lib, please increase RELEASE.
5# The versionnumber is extracted from apt-pkg/init.h - see also there.
6LIBAPTPKG_MAJOR=$(shell awk -v ORS='.' '/^\#define APT_PKG_M/ {print $$3}' $(BASE)/apt-pkg/init.h | sed 's/\.$$//')
7LIBAPTPKG_RELEASE=$(shell grep -E '^\#define APT_PKG_RELEASE' $(BASE)/apt-pkg/init.h | cut -d ' ' -f 3)
8
9# Version number of libapt-inst
10# Please increase MAJOR with each ABI break,
11# with each non-ABI break to the lib, please increase MINOR.
12# The versionnumber is extracted from apt-inst/makefile - see also there.
13LIBAPTINST_MAJOR=$(shell egrep '^MAJOR=' $(BASE)/apt-inst/makefile |cut -d '=' -f 2)
14LIBAPTINST_MINOR=$(shell egrep '^MINOR=' $(BASE)/apt-inst/makefile |cut -d '=' -f 2)
c0a73937
DK
15
16# FIXME: In previous releases this lovely variable includes
17# the detected libc and libdc++ version. As this is bogus we
18# want to drop this, but this a ABI break.
19# And we don't want to do this now. So we hardcode a value here,
20# and drop it later on (hopefully as fast as possible).
21LIBEXT=-libc6.9-6